Illinois has another provision in the statute, which often protects lawyers involved in estate planning. 5/13-214.3(d) provides that: When the injury caused by the act or omission does not occur until the death of the person for whom the professional services were rendered, the action may be commenced within 2 years after the date of the person’s death unless letters of office are issued or the person’s will is admitted to probate within that 2 year period, in which… [read post]

City of Toledo Police Dept., 785 F.3d 1128 (6th 2015) (a concerned citizen called 911 to report that a man was walking down the street with his wife and dog, wearing a handgun on his hip; an officer was dispatched and detained the man, who later sued the police; reviewing the district court’s denial of pretrial qualified immunity, the Sixth Circuit held that it was clear that open carry alone does not provide reasonable suspicion in Ohio, where open carry is legal) United… [read post]

In 2008, Congress amended the Foreign Intelligence Surveillance Act (FISA) by adding Section 702, allowing the U.S. government to acquire critically important intelligence from foreign targets using U.S. telecommunications services. [read post]
